who died of a heroin overdose.
At the time of its release, it raised several controversities because of the crudeness of the lyrics.
The song proved to be a surprise hit, definitively launching Venditti's career.
In spite of being one of Venditti's major hits, Venditti rarely performs the song live, and only in Milan.
